"""
|
|
|
|
This module is the word filter to be used...
|
|
|
|
"""
|
|
|
|
import string
|
|
|
|
import re
|
|
|
|
|
|
|
|
# Rating levels
|
|
|
|
xRatedG = 0
|
|
|
|
xRatedPG = 1
|
|
|
|
xRatedPG13 = 2
|
|
|
|
xRatedR = 3
|
|
|
|
xRatedX = 4
|
|
|
|
|
|
|
|
class LanguageFilter:
|
|
|
|
def __init__(self):
|
|
|
|
pass
|
|
|
|
def test(self,sentence):
|
|
|
|
"returns censored sentence"
|
|
|
|
return xRatedG
|
|
|
|
def censor(self,sentence,censorLevel):
|
|
|
|
"returns censored sentence"
|
|
|
|
return sentence
|
|
|
|
|
|
|
|
class ExactMatchListFilter(LanguageFilter):
|
|
|
|
def __init__(self,wordlist):
|
|
|
|
self.wordlist = wordlist
|
|
|
|
def test(self,sentence):
|
|
|
|
"return the rating of sentence in question"
|
|
|
|
rated = xRatedG # assume rated lowest level
|
|
|
|
startidx = 0
|
|
|
|
for endidx in range(len(sentence)):
|
|
|
|
if sentence[endidx] in string.whitespace or sentence[endidx] in string.punctuation:
|
|
|
|
if startidx != endidx:
|
|
|
|
try:
|
|
|
|
# find and get rating and substitute
|
|
|
|
rating = self.wordlist[string.lower(sentence[startidx:endidx])]
|
|
|
|
except LookupError:
|
|
|
|
# couldn't find word
|
|
|
|
rating = None
|
|
|
|
if rating != None and rating.rating > rated:
|
|
|
|
# substitute into string
|
|
|
|
rated = rating.rating
|
|
|
|
startidx = endidx + 1
|
|
|
|
if startidx < len(sentence):
|
|
|
|
try:
|
|
|
|
# find and get rating and substitute
|
|
|
|
rating = self.wordlist[string.lower(sentence[startidx:])]
|
|
|
|
except LookupError:
|
|
|
|
# couldn't find word
|
|
|
|
rating = None
|
|
|
|
if rating != None and rating.rating > rated:
|
|
|
|
# substitute into string
|
|
|
|
rated = rating.rating
|
|
|
|
return rated
|
|
|
|
|
|
|
|
def censor(self,sentence,censorLevel):
|
|
|
|
"censors a sentence to a rating"
|
|
|
|
# break into words, but perserve original punctuation
|
|
|
|
censored = ""
|
|
|
|
startidx = 0
|
|
|
|
for endidx in range(len(sentence)):
|
|
|
|
if sentence[endidx] in string.whitespace or sentence[endidx] in string.punctuation:
|
|
|
|
if startidx != endidx:
|
|
|
|
try:
|
|
|
|
# find and get rating and substitute
|
|
|
|
rating = self.wordlist[string.lower(sentence[startidx:endidx])]
|
|
|
|
except LookupError:
|
|
|
|
# couldn't find word
|
|
|
|
rating = None
|
|
|
|
if rating != None and rating.rating > censorLevel:
|
|
|
|
# substitute into string
|
|
|
|
censored += rating.substitute + sentence[endidx]
|
|
|
|
else:
|
|
|
|
censored += sentence[startidx:endidx] + sentence[endidx]
|
|
|
|
else:
|
|
|
|
censored += sentence[startidx]
|
|
|
|
startidx = endidx + 1
|
|
|
|
if startidx < len(sentence):
|
|
|
|
# Special after loop processing!
|
|
|
|
try:
|
|
|
|
# find and get rating and substitute
|
|
|
|
rating = self.wordlist[string.lower(sentence[startidx:])]
|
|
|
|
except LookupError:
|
|
|
|
# couldn't find word
|
|
|
|
rating = None
|
|
|
|
if rating != None and rating.rating > censorLevel:
|
|
|
|
# substitute into string
|
|
|
|
censored += rating.substitute
|
|
|
|
else:
|
|
|
|
censored += sentence[startidx:]
|
|
|
|
return censored
|
|
|
|
|
|
|
|
class REFilter(LanguageFilter):
|
|
|
|
def __init__(self,regexp,rating):
|
|
|
|
self.compiledRE = re.compile(regexp, re.IGNORECASE | re.MULTILINE )
|
|
|
|
if not isinstance(rating,Rating):
|
|
|
|
PtDebugPrint("ptWordFilter: rating for %s not of type Rating" % (regexp))
|
|
|
|
self.rating = rating
|
|
|
|
def test(self,sentence):
|
|
|
|
"return the rating of sentence in question"
|
|
|
|
if self.compiledRE.search(sentence) != None:
|
|
|
|
return self.rating.rating
|
|
|
|
return xRatedG
|
|
|
|
def censor(self,sentence,censorLevel):
|
|
|
|
"censors a sentence to a rating"
|
|
|
|
if self.rating.rating > censorLevel:
|
|
|
|
if self.compiledRE.search(sentence) != None:
|
|
|
|
return self.compiledRE.sub(self.rating.substitute,sentence)
|
|
|
|
return sentence
|
|
|
|
|
|
|
|
class Rating:
|
|
|
|
"substitute can be string for exact substitute or number of splat replacement"
|
|
|
|
def __init__(self,rating,subtitute="*****"):
|
|
|
|
self.rating = rating
|
|
|
|
self.substitute = subtitute
|
